Topic: Your integrity counts [Tuesday 13 October, 2015]

“Let your light so shine before men, that they may see your good works, and glorify your Father which is in heaven.”-Matthew 5:16

A lot of youth fall short of the integrity test. They cannot be trusted, especially with their words. Integrity is what sums you up and that’s what gives you respect in the eyes of all. Integrity is like a ray of light that is meant to shine. Light is most appreciated in darkness, so your integrity is most appreciated anywhere you find yourself, especially where evil prevails.

For instance, in your home, you must be known as a man or woman of integrity. If you are found wanting, how can you then teach your household integrity? Your life cannot count outside your home if you are not having a positive impact on your family. You should constantly ask yourself what testimony they have of you at the home front. That is one sure way to weigh in on if you are on the right track or not.

Another place your life of integrity will be much valued is in your neighbourhood. Apart from your family learning to trust your words, those around you also need to trust you. And you know you can only gain that trust by being integrity conscious. Your life is meant to count, but not without integrity. Your integrity speaks louder than your voice.

Also, how are you seen at your work place? Are you known as being two-faced, or can you be relied on? If your colleagues doubt almost everything that comes from you, then you should check it. As someone who will serve as a positive influence to others, you must be trustworthy. This is not only in words, but deeds. People should be able to trust you with their valuables, money and even lives. This shows that every aspect of one’s life needs integrity to follow through. So, you must begin to work on yours, if you are found wanting in any area. Integrity is life, keep it!
